The loudun possessions was a notorious witchcraft trial in loudun, france in 1634. The story centers around a group of 17th century ursuline nuns who, feigning madness, were officially declared possessed and forced to undergo public exorcism. It is a historical narrative of supposed demonic possession, religious fanaticism, sexual repression, and mass hysteria that occurred in seventeenthcentury france surrounding unexplained events that took place in the small town of loudun.
